That is right, fish quarantine is basically to avoid spreading parasites, bacterial and fungal diseases but basically the one things to be careful about with corals are montipora nudis, brown jelly, acro flat worms and red bugs and because there is no effective dip I know of for either jelly, nudis nor acro flat worms really the only one left is red bugs which mainly affects acros and trated with interceptor.
Quarantine will sooner or later show if you got any of the other three.
